Я пытаюсь использовать dhtmlxscheduler в приложении ASP.NET MVC 5, следуя руководству, доступному по адресу http://docs.dhtmlx.com/scheduler/how_to_start.html, но не имеющему большой радости. Я добавил v4.1.1 скрипты и css в свой проект через NuGet.Использование dhtmlxscheduler с ASP.NET MVC5
Я создал новый проект и создал новый вид без макета, действие контроллера просто служит представлению. Ниже приведен HTML в моем представлении, но страница полностью очищает, что я делаю неправильно? Кроме того, как я могу заставить это работать с представлением, которое использует макет?
Я знаю, что есть версия dhtmlxscheduler .NET, но для этого требуется лицензия.
@{
Layout = null;
}
<!DOCTYPE html>
<html>
<head>
<meta name="viewport" content="width=device-width" />
<title>How to start</title>
<script src="@Url.Content("~/Scripts/dhtmlxscheduler/dhtmlxscheduler.js")" type="text/javascript"></script>
<link rel="stylesheet" href="@Url.Content("~/Content/dhtmlxscheduler/dhtmlxscheduler.css")" type="text/css">
<style type="text/css" media="screen">
html, body {
margin: 0px;
padding: 0px;
height: 100%;
overflow: hidden;
}
</style>
<script>
scheduler.init("scheduler_here", new Date(), "month");
</script>
</head>
<body>
<div>
<div id="scheduler_here" class="dhx_cal_container" style="width:100%; height:100%;">
<div class="dhx_cal_navline">
<div class="dhx_cal_prev_button"> </div>
<div class="dhx_cal_next_button"> </div>
<div class="dhx_cal_today_button"></div>
<div class="dhx_cal_date"></div>
<div class="dhx_cal_tab" id="day_tab" style="right:204px;"></div>
<div class="dhx_cal_tab" id="week_tab" style="right:140px;"></div>
<div class="dhx_cal_tab" id="month_tab" style="right:76px;"></div>
</div>
<div class="dhx_cal_header"></div>
<div class="dhx_cal_data"></div>
</div>
</div>
</body>
</html>